Has anyone purchased a Suzuki chromatic harmonica (specifically a sirius or maret model) off of ebay from one of the japanese sellers? They are available for half of what you would pay from a dealer here in the states, but on Suzuki's website there is a notice not to purchase from any but an authorized US dealer, so I am wondering if these are authentic suzuki models, or cheaper knock-offs. Shure SM57 Unidyne III Microphones are regarded for their durability and ruggedness. This is an older one that was made in the U.S.A. They sound a lot better than the new mexican made 57. This microphone works great as a studio mic and live pick-up mic on vocals, instruments, amplifiers, and favored among drummers to record the snare.
